Security readout for executives and security teams
This is a 2013 Oracle Java Runtime Environment flaw affecting Java SE 7 Update 21 and earlier. Public details are sparse, but the CVE says a remote attacker could impact confidentiality, integrity, and availability through the Java Deployment component. Treat remaining installations as legacy risk requiring removal or vendor-guided update. Exposure is most likely where old Oracle Java SE 7 Update 21 or earlier JRE deployments remain installed, especially on systems processing untrusted Java content or relying on browser/deployment functionality. Prioritize as high for environments with legacy Java still present. The issue is old, but any remaining vulnerable runtime represents avoidable exposure with broad potential impact and limited public technical detail. Mitigation focus: Inventory systems for Oracle Java SE 7 Update 21 or earlier.; Apply vendor updates or removals referenced by Oracle and downstream vendors.; Disable unused Java browser or deployment functionality where feasible..
